ESC GS 4 m n

[Name]

Select red/black substitute function [ESC 4/5 setting]

[Defined Area]

m = 1, 2, 49, 50

When m = 1, 49 n = 0 to 3, 255

When m = 2, 50 n = 0, 2 to 5

When m = 83 n = 0, 1

[Initial Value]

Memory switch setting

[Function]

Selects red/black substitute function

Selects characters targeted for adornment with m = 1 (ANK) or m = 2 (Kanji characters), and selects the

<ESC> "4”/<ESC> “5” command functions with n.

Sets the handling of adornment to space characters (ASCII 20Hex) with m = 83 (“S”).

This command is enabled only when in a state where adornment is cancelled by <ESC> “4” (when <ESC> “5”

was specified).

When using <ESC> “5“ to cancel adornments, it returns to the previously set adornments. (Adornments such as under-
line, upper line, double-tall expanded and enhancing are cancelled if there is no command to set them (for example the
<ESC> “-“ 1 specification for underlines).

Precautions for selecting <Option 1>
1.

Prints white/black inverted characters using 5 x 9 fonts regardless of the current font size

setting.

2.

Inserts a one dot string of black printing to the head of the white/black inverted charac-

ters.

3.

Printing data created on a conventional red/black printer, using 1 and 2 above, there are

cases in which the printing position will shift to the right and a line of printable characters

reduced.

4.

Download registered characters defined with 5 x9 fonts are printed regardless of the cur-

rent font setting (7x9/5x9).

5.

Must not set “ANK default dot count = many” with the memory switch. (This will cause a

white line to appear between characters.)

Precautions for selecting <Option 2> and <Option 3>
1.

Do not apply an upper line or an underline when rotating 90 or 270 degrees.
